                  #9
                  Originally posted by Weebler I
                  Pushed back until the start of March.
                  They touched on this during Steve Kim's latest pod cast that the investors are getting a bit nervous due to how low the ratings have dropped on Showtime.

                  When Haymon got his financial backing to start all this, he was coming off the 2013 Showtime season which was surprisingly strong, but then in 2014 he reverted back to his old style of match making that got him kicked off HBO.
